Output faa84fa83cf7ac7f18230920a5fbebd482f1d44fd4a23f0211b39cd024b8b0ff:130

value
12050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f641ef74402e2e8f76f27da6bbb7d652235602bd OP_EQUAL
address
3Q9791Ag8HcyBSdqdFsYFjuGABp4TieNSx
transaction
faa84fa83cf7ac7f18230920a5fbebd482f1d44fd4a23f0211b39cd024b8b0ff
confirmations
180010
spent
true